为您找到相关结果283,595个
Python Selenium自动化实现网页操控_python_脚本之家
Selenium 是一个用于 Web 应用程序测试的工具,支持多种浏览器(如 Chrome、Firefox、Edge 等)。WebDriver 是 Selenium 的核心组件,用于控制浏览器行为并执行自动化操作。元素定位是通过各种方式(如 ID、Class Name、XPath 等)在网页上找到特定元素。 2 为什么要使用 Selenium 自动化 Seleniu
www.jb51.net/python/346808m...htm 2025-8-15
Python使用Selenium实现浏览器打印预览功能_python_脚本之家
首先,我们需要安装Selenium库。可以使用pip来安装,打开终端并执行以下命令: 1 pipinstallselenium 另外,我们需要下载相应浏览器的驱动程序。Selenium支持多种浏览器,如Chrome、Firefox、Edge等。根据你使用的浏览器,在Selenium的官方网站(https://www.selenium.dev/documentation/en/webdriver/driver_requirements/)上下载对应...
www.jb51.net/python/304327n...htm 2025-8-20
Python中Selenium上传文件的几种方式_python_脚本之家
如果能直接在页面当中看到这个input元素,那么通过 selenium 的 send_keys 方法就能完成文件的上传,在参数中传入本地文件的路径。 1 2 3 4 driver.get('<https://testpages.herokuapp.com/styled/file-upload-test.html>') el=driver.find_element('id',"fileinput") ...
www.jb51.net/article/2564...htm 2025-8-14
Python使用Selenium执行JavaScript代码的步骤详解_python_脚本之家
下面是一些常见的应用示例,展示了如何使用Python Selenium执行JavaScript代码: 1. 模拟点击按钮 有时候,我们需要模拟点击页面上的某个按钮。可以使用JavaScript来实现这个功能。 1 driver.execute_script("document.querySelector('.btn').click();") 这段代码会模拟点击页面上class为"btn"的按钮。
www.jb51.net/python/304331h...htm 2025-8-14
python+selenium使用xpath定位的问题及解决_python_脚本之家
python selenium xpath高级定位用法 目前很多网页前端代码是框架或 JS 生成的,就导致了混乱而难以定位。 为了快速而又复杂定位 Selenium 中有一个 Xpath 选择器,可以选择复杂的页面定位,也是爬虫在网页定位中的较优的选择。 1、通过绝对路径定位元素 1 driver.find_element_by_xpath("html/body/div/form/input") ...
www.jb51.net/python/3212504...htm 2025-8-12